Staffing Ratio Comparison
How Freeman Catholic College's student-to-teacher ratio compares to state and national averages.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student.
14.2:1
12.7:1
12.3:1
With a ratio of 14.2:1, this school's ratio is higher than the NSW average (12.7:1) and the national average (12.3:1).
